Whamcloud - gitweb
b=23289 revert patch on 21828
[fs/lustre-release.git] / lustre / ldlm / ldlm_lib.c
index fb20bad..6a8f448 100644 (file)
@@ -1124,10 +1124,6 @@ static void target_request_copy_get(struct ptlrpc_request *req)
         cfs_atomic_inc(&req->rq_refcount);
         /** let export know it has replays to be handled */
         cfs_atomic_inc(&req->rq_export->exp_replay_count);
-        /* release service thread while request is queued 
-         * we are moving the request from active processing
-         * to waiting on the replay queue */
-        ptlrpc_server_active_request_dec(req);
 }
 
 static void target_request_copy_put(struct ptlrpc_request *req)
@@ -1137,8 +1133,6 @@ static void target_request_copy_put(struct ptlrpc_request *req)
 
         cfs_atomic_dec(&req->rq_export->exp_replay_count);
         class_export_rpc_put(req->rq_export);
-        /* ptlrpc_server_drop_request() assumes the request is active */
-        ptlrpc_server_active_request_inc(req);
         ptlrpc_server_drop_request(req);
 }